Option 2: Request a Pay Stub from Your Employer (If Using Money Network for Payroll)
If you're using Money Network for payroll purposes and your employer provides pay via Money Network, they may already provide you with a detailed pay stub or payroll summary. In this case, follow these steps:
Step-by-Step Instructions:
1. Check Your Email or Employer Portal
- Your employer might send you pay stubs directly via email or through an employee portal. Many employers offer digital pay stubs that include information such as gross pay, deductions, and net pay.
2. Contact Your Employer’s HR or Payroll Department
- If you don't have access to a pay stub or payroll summary, contact your employer's HR or Payroll department. They can provide you with an official pay stub or direct you to where you can access it online.
